    Logistics Advisor - Jigawa

    Background: 

    • The purpose of the USAID Global Health Supply Chain Program–Procurement and Supply Management single award IDIQ contract is to ensure uninterrupted supplies of health commodities to prevent suffering, save lives, and create a brighter future for families around the world.
    • The IDIQ has four task orders that directly support the U.S. President’s Emergency Plan for AIDS Relief (PEPFAR), the President’s Malaria Initiative (PMI), and USAID’s family planning and reproductive health program.
    • GHSC-PSM provides health commodity procurement services and systems strengthening technical assistance that address all elements of a comprehensive supply chain. All four task orders are implemented in Nigeria.

    Principal Duties and Responsibilities

    • Maintain a work plan for PSM project for Public Health Commodities Logistics system strengthening activities in collaboration with staff and partners.
    • Provide support in coordinating technical assistance to State Ministries of Health and stakeholders within the state for the implementation and management of the Logistics Management System for HIV, Family Planning, malaria, and TB programs to ensure uninterrupted commodity availability in supported health facilities.
    • Monitor and provide supportive supervision to the state level teams as appropriate.
    • Coordinate feedback to health facilities and support performance improvement strategies relating to commodity management challenges through routine monitoring and supportive visits.
    • Collaborate with other PSM staff in harmonization of efforts for the logistics systems in the health sector to establish a harmonized commodity logistics system including logistics management information system (LMIS) for use in managing all different commodity groups
    • Work closely with the manager on managing relationships and maintaining routine communications with stakeholders
    • Help write quarterly and annual reports for submission to program funders
    • Contribute to identifying best practices and success stories for PSM's periodic logistics bulletin
    • Participate in annual national/state quantification and procurement planning of PH commodities, in collaboration with all program stakeholders and partners
    • Maintain a good knowledge and understanding of all office rules and procedures as set forth in the field office policy manual
    • Support achievement of the overall project goals as required to ensure project performance.
    • Any other duties as assigned

    Facility Level Reporting, Replenishment and Receiving:

    • Ensure donor-procured health commodities “stock on-hand” in health facilities continuously falls within the min/max range established for each product by supporting the LMCU to:
    • Collate distribution plans, last mile delivery (LMD) orders, truck schedules, etc. to support last mile delivery (LMD)
    • Support assessment activities (EUV, storage facilities, supply chain, LIAT, LSAT, etc.)
    • Support LMIS report collection and LMD activities at the state level
    • Support the role out and implementation of an e-LMIS system (NAVISION) at the state
    • Facilitate the reporting of stock status for programs the project support in the state
    • Ensure effective monitoring of last mile distribution activities in the state and promptly report incidences emanating from the LMD for resolution
